The Configuration Management System is a component of the change management system responsible for evaluating, testing, and documenting changes to the project scope and ensuring that these changes are systematically managed. It tracks and controls changes in project deliverables, including identifying which components are affected by the changes and ensuring they are properly documented and communicated.
